Don't change the sweeper's batch logic here. The Maravel retention sweeper is deliberately slow: it deletes in small batches with pauses so it never starves the primary. Your patch removes the pause, which will lock the ledger table during business hours. Keep the structure, tune the constants instead, and get review from whoever owns retention policy. For reference, the values we run in production are these.

constants for fajop-tahaf:
RATE_LIMITS = {
    "holael": 2,
    "oliael": 10,
    "druael": 10,
    "wenwyn": 10,
}

Handover: Fenwick shift to Orla. Plugin authors on Glintway have reported cold starts up to four seconds on the Varrow runtime when handlers exceed the bundle ceiling. We now pre-warm a pool of twelve workers and keep them pinned for ten minutes after each invocation. The current pre-warm settings your plugin inherits are listed below.

service settings:
[quenath]
host = quenath.zemvarcorp.corp
user = quenath_svc
database = quenath_prod

Legacy Pricing Adjustment — Managers Only

From April, customers on the pre-2021 Corvane Analytics contracts move to current list pricing, phased over two billing cycles. Heads of department should brief account owners but hold external communication until the notice pack from Tomas Elvered's team is final. Retention offers apply only to accounts flagged by Marit Oslund. The rationale is recorded in the confidential note below.

board note of kageg-bahof: The renewal with Holwynax Holdings closes at $2 million a year, 5 percent below the last contract. Project Ulaath slips by two quarters because of the supplier delay.